Debbie launched a toy rocket off a hill next to Lake Lakewood. The height h of the rocket in feet above the surface of the lake
jenyasd209 [6]

Answer:

t = 8.69 s

Step-by-step explanation:

The height h of the rocket in feet above the surface of the lake can be modeled by :

h=340+100t-16t^2

Let we need to find the time to reach the ground. When it reach the ground, h = 0

340+100t-16t^2=0

We need to find the value of t.

t = 8.69 s and -2.45 s

Neglecting negative value,

t = 8.69 s

Hence, it will take 8.69 s to reach the ground.
